PDA

View Full Version : سوال: گذاشتن شماره ردیف در چاپ گزارش ؟



SilverLearn
پنج شنبه 06 آذر 1393, 18:12 عصر
با سلام

میخواستم بدونم چجوری میشه در چاپ گزارش شماره ردیف برای رکوردها گذاشت که از شماره 1 شروع بشه و...

مثل :

1
2
3
4

با تشکر

ایلیا آخوندزاده
جمعه 07 آذر 1393, 14:12 عصر
باسلام و درود
اگه از دیتارپورت استفاده می کنید در منوی راست کلیک :

SilverLearn
جمعه 07 آذر 1393, 14:44 عصر
درود
اما فکر کنم این روش شماره ردیف برای رکورد ها نمیگذاره !

m.4.r.m
جمعه 07 آذر 1393, 16:16 عصر
جواب ايليا جان برای شماره صفحه بود ؛

خب اگه شما بخوای برای گزارش هات ردیف بزاری باید تو جدول مورد نظر یک فیلد بزاری به اسم ردیف ، هر سری که اطلاعات در جدول ذخیره می کنی +1 هم به فیلد ردیف اضافه کنی تا موقع چاپ راحت این فیلد خوش بعنوان ردیف استفاده میشه

SilverLearn
جمعه 07 آذر 1393, 16:18 عصر
این کار که خیلی غیر حرفه ای هست به نظر من
یعنی در ویژوال بیسیک هیچ روشی برای این کار نیست !

m.4.r.m
جمعه 07 آذر 1393, 16:22 عصر
آخه همچبن میگی غیر منطقی انگار وی بی رو با اکسل اشتباه گرفتی برنامه نویسی یعنی برای هر کار برنامه بنویسی مگر اینکه محیط گزارش گیری مثه کریستال ریپورت همچین قابلیتی رو داشته باشه

SilverLearn
جمعه 07 آذر 1393, 16:25 عصر
اولا بنده نگفتم غیر منطقی !
دوما الان بحث ما کریستال ریپورت نیست وگرنه همچین امکانی را دارد
سوما توابع کتابخانه ای به چه درد می خورند !؟ برای اینکه برنامه نویس فکرش رو به همچین امکانات کوچکی درگیر نکند !
در هر صورت ممنون از راهنمایی

vbhamed
شنبه 08 آذر 1393, 18:07 عصر
سلام
گزارشگر و بانكتون چيه ؟

SilverLearn
یک شنبه 09 آذر 1393, 17:03 عصر
سلام

بانک اکسس هست و با dataReport خود ویژوال بیسیک این کار انجام شده است

vbhamed
دوشنبه 10 آذر 1393, 00:17 صبح
سلام
براي ديتاريپورت و با وجود بانك اكسس فكر نمي‌كنم راهي جز گذاشتن فيلد شماره رديف در جدولوتون داشته باشيد
اگر بانك Sql server بود با استفاده از امكانات خود Sql مي‌شد كاري كرد يا اينكه از گزارشگرهاي قويتري مثل Crystal و FastReport استفاده كنيد